Thrity years on mission in Central Africa changed Dr. Daniel Fountain's thinking about his professional training, about current medical practice overseas and at home, and about the responsibility of the entire Christian community to promote health initiatives.  Digging into biblical precepts and patterns, he has developed a theology of human well-ness that is some ways rebukes his own profession, and at the same time summons churches to recover their rightful role as partners with physicians.  His diagnosis of shortcomings by both will unsettle traditionalists.  His suggested remedies will be controversial.  But gainsayers will be hardpressed to refute the evidence from his diligent research and devout experience.
